Description:

Triumvirate was formed in 1969 in Cologne, Germany. The band was named after the unique political style of the Roman Empire in B.C., and consisted of three members (keyboards, guitar & bass, and drums), and although the band was greatly influenced by the musical styles of The Nice and Emerson Lake & Palmer, it gradually developed its originality as a band. In 1974, the band began recording a new album. The album, consisting of two suites of songs, was well received by FM stations in the U.S. and reached the top of the airplay charts, leading to its release in the U.S. The album was also released in the U.S.The band also opened for Fleetwood Mac and played 41 concerts in the U.S., and the album reached No. 55 on the U.S. album charts. Prior to this tour, the band performed a studio show for radio promotion at Ultrasonic Recording Studios in New York City on October 1 of the same year, performing two medleys from the album in their entirety. This live album is a complete recording of this studio show. Jürgen Fritz's playing overwhelmed the audience with a technical and dramatic performance that was influenced by Keith Emerson but surpassed it. Incidentally, the opening number is from the next album. The success of this album led to the release of "Spartacus" in 1975, which reached No. 27 on the U.S. album chart. The album includes an additional bonus track, a performance from the following year's U.S. tour.
